It provided four singles, one of which, 'Against All Odds (Take A Look At Me Now)' featuring Mariah Carey, gave the band their 6th UK #1. Their second album, Coast to Coast debuted at #1 in the UK album charts. Westlife's self-titled debut album contained five singles which topped the UK charts, although the album itself reached only the number two spot in the UK. Their appeal spanned the generations, with women of a certain age enjoying the good-looking lads whose music was being played by their grandchildren. The Irish lads were off to a flying start with their musical career, with three consecutive number ones. It stayed in the UK chart for 13 weeks and was 1999's 'Record of the Year' – voted for by the public. 'Flying Without Wings', the group's signature tune, was a smash and brought them worldwide fame. The band's second single, 'If I Let You Go', quickly followed and that also made #1. Singer Ronan Keating of fellow Irish band Boyzone was touted as being Westlife's manager, but this was later revealed to be a publicity stunt, their actual manager was Louis Walsh. It hit the #1 spot in the UK and they had their first appearance on Top Of The Pops within nine months of Westlife being created. The five lads, as Westlife, released their debut single 'Swear It Again' in 1999. The final line-up included original Westside members Kian Egan, Mark Feehily and Shane Filan, with the addition of Bryan McFadden and Nicky Byrne who made it through the audition.Ī different name had to be chosen for the new group because there was already an American band called Westside. He must have chosen a better tune to sing as he was immediately selected for the new boy band. Cowell initially rejected bleached-blonde Shane Filan, who returned to audition again after reverting to his natural dark hair. The band were brought to Cowell's attention by his friend Louis Walsh, who had been badgered by Mae Filan to hear her son's group sing. Their musical influences were Michael Jackson and the Backstreet Boys. In 1998 pop mogul Simon Cowell did a little tweaking with the line-up of Westside, a group of young Irish male singers who went to school together.

Within the parameters of the genre, Westlife achieved excellence. The boy band genre is one of the most difficult and demanding areas in the music industry, with many casualties who have been unable to keep up with the workload, the clean-cut image and the derision from serious music fans. They set a new chart record for having their first seven singles go to number one and had massive merchandising sales. Westlife remain one of Ireland's best-selling musical acts.
